Common Damage Restoration Issues in Wellington, Colorado
Wellington's location along Colorado's Front Range creates specific vulnerabilities that property owners must understand. The area's elevation changes, soil composition, and weather patterns contribute to recurring damage scenarios.
Water-related problems dominate local restoration calls:
- Basement flooding from rapid snowmelt and spring runoff
- Frozen pipe bursts during temperature fluctuations
- Foundation seepage from clay soil expansion
- Appliance failures in older homes with outdated plumbing
- Roof leaks from hail damage and wind-driven rain
Fire and smoke damage often results from:
- Wildfire proximity during dry seasons
- Electrical issues in aging wiring systems
- Heating equipment malfunctions during winter months
- Kitchen fires from cooking accidents
Mold growth accelerates in Wellington's variable humidity conditions, especially after water events. Sewage backups occur when municipal systems overwhelm during heavy precipitation or when private septic systems fail.
Early warning signs include musty odors, water stains, peeling paint, warped flooring, and visible mold growth. Residents should monitor basements, crawl spaces, and attics where problems often begin unnoticed.

Seasonal Damage Patterns in Wellington
Wellington experiences distinct seasonal damage patterns that property owners should anticipate and prepare for throughout the year.
Spring (March-May):
- Snowmelt flooding in basements and crawl spaces
- Roof leaks from ice dam damage
- Mold growth from winter moisture accumulation
- Plumbing failures as systems thaw
Summer (June-August):
- Severe thunderstorm water damage
- Hail damage leading to roof leaks
- Wildfire smoke infiltration
- Air conditioning condensation problems
Fall (September-November):
- Heating system fires and carbon monoxide issues
- Leaf-clogged gutters causing overflow
- Early freeze pipe bursts
- Chimney and fireplace damage
Winter (December-February):
- Frozen pipe catastrophic failures
- Ice dam water intrusion
- Heating equipment malfunctions
- Snow load roof damage
Understanding these patterns helps property owners schedule preventive maintenance and recognize seasonal risk factors before they become expensive restoration projects.
Housing Characteristics & Restoration Considerations
Wellington's housing stock reflects different construction eras, each presenting unique restoration challenges and opportunities. Understanding these characteristics helps property owners make informed decisions about damage prevention and restoration approaches.
Housing types and considerations:
- Historic homes (pre-1960) - original plumbing and electrical systems prone to failure
- Ranch-style homes (1960s-1980s) - slab foundations with limited access for water damage
- Contemporary builds (1990s-present) - modern materials with different drying requirements
- Rural properties - well water systems and septic considerations
- Mobile homes - specialized structural and moisture concerns
Construction materials significantly impact restoration methods:
- Older homes often feature plaster walls requiring specialized drying techniques
- Hardwood floors in vintage properties need careful moisture extraction
- Modern synthetic materials may off-gas during fire damage
- Insulation types affect mold remediation approaches
- Foundation materials influence water intrusion patterns
Many Wellington homes lack proper vapor barriers, making them susceptible to moisture problems. Crawl space access varies widely, affecting restoration equipment placement and drying efficiency. Understanding these factors helps restoration professionals develop targeted approaches that address each property's specific vulnerabilities and structural characteristics.
Environmental Conditions & Damage Implications
Wellington's environmental conditions create specific challenges for property damage restoration that differ from other Colorado communities. The area's unique geography, climate patterns, and soil composition directly influence damage types and restoration requirements.
Climate factors affecting restoration:
- Elevation (5,000+ feet) - lower air pressure affects drying equipment performance
- Dry air conditions - rapid moisture evaporation but static electricity issues
- Temperature extremes - freeze-thaw cycles stress building materials
- Wind patterns - drive moisture into structures and spread fire damage
- UV exposure - degrades roofing and siding materials over time
Soil and water considerations:
- Expansive clay soils shift foundations and crack basement walls
- High water table areas experience seasonal flooding
- Well water quality affects cleanup procedures
- Alkaline soil conditions impact drainage systems
- Mineral deposits in water complicate extraction processes
Air quality factors influence restoration approaches. Dust from agricultural activities and construction projects can complicate smoke damage assessment. Seasonal pollen loads affect filtration requirements during restoration. Wildfire smoke from distant fires infiltrates structures, requiring specialized cleaning protocols.
These environmental factors require restoration professionals to adapt standard procedures for Wellington's specific conditions. Equipment must function efficiently at elevation, and drying calculations must account for local humidity and temperature variations.
Agricultural Property Damage Restoration Considerations
Wellington's agricultural heritage and active farming community create unique restoration challenges that require specialized knowledge and equipment. Rural properties, farm buildings, and agricultural operations face distinct damage scenarios that differ significantly from residential restoration projects.
Agricultural structures present complex restoration needs:
- Barn and outbuilding fires spread rapidly due to stored materials
- Livestock facilities require immediate cleanup to prevent disease
- Grain storage areas need specialized moisture control
- Equipment sheds contain valuable machinery requiring careful protection
- Irrigation systems create unique water damage patterns
Farm-specific contamination issues demand expert handling:
- Animal waste creates biohazard conditions requiring specialized cleanup
- Chemical storage areas need hazmat protocols during restoration
- Feed contamination from water or fire damage affects livestock safety
- Fuel spills from equipment create environmental concerns
- Pesticide exposure requires specialized safety measures
Restoration timelines become critical during planting and harvest seasons. Delays can cost farmers entire growing seasons, making rapid response and efficient restoration processes essential. Emergency services must coordinate with agricultural schedules and understand the economic impact of extended downtime.
Insurance considerations for agricultural properties often involve multiple policies covering structures, equipment, livestock, and crop losses. Restoration professionals must document damage thoroughly and understand agricultural insurance requirements to help farmers recover quickly and completely from property damage events.
